Job Overview: Complete all assigned prep list items and set up kitchen line stations. Maintain product presentations, product quality and quantity, and preparation time standards. Prepare all menu items according to recipes, plate presentations and specifications. Maintain the organization, cleanliness and sanitation of work areas and equipment.

Essential Job Functions:

  1. Perform opening procedures and set up kitchen line stations.
  2. Complete all assigned food prep list items for the day.
  3. Measure ingredients required for specific food items being prepared. Wash, cut, and prepare foods designated for cooking.
  4. Prepare food items according to designated recipes and quality standards. Follow recipes, portion controls, and presentation specifications as set by the Chef.
  5. Manage guest orders in a timely and efficient manner.
  6. Prepare dishes for guests with food allergies or intolerances.
  7. Visually inspect all food sent from the kitchen.
  8. Maintain the highest level of standards of quality products at all times.
  9. Maintain full knowledge of food product and menu items.
  10. Maintain cleanliness and comply with food sanitation standards at all times.
  11. Prepare staff meals according to the menu.
  12. Assist in preparing items for Banquets according to the menu.
  13. Stock and maintain designated food stations throughout the shift.
  14. Transport food supplies from storeroom or freezer, using trolley/basket to kitchen. Return surplus food to storeroom or freezer.
  15. Follow correct food handling procedures according to federal, state, local and company regulations.
  16. Store food according to health codes, ensure food safety by dating and rotating food containers, safely storing perishables, and maintaining a sanitary work environment.
  17. Take an ongoing inventory of ingredients, stock and maintain sufficient levels of food on the line.
  18. Prepare requisitions for supplies and food items, as needed.
  19. Control food waste, loss and usage.
  20. Use proper knife skills.
  21. Check equipment and tools daily to ensure they are in good working condition and promptly report any defects/malfunctions to a supervisor.
  22. Maintain high standards of personal appearance and personal hygiene.
  23. Demonstrate ability to multi-task, manage time and work well under pressure.
  24. Maintain knowledge of all safety and emergency procedures and is aware of accident prevention policies.
  25. Maintain a professional courteous manner with all fellow employees.
  26. Assist with special and deep cleaning projects as assigned by a supervisor.
  27. Perform any other duties as requested by supervisor.
